I believe that during birth, women not only give birth to their babies, but also give birth to themselves as mothers. The way that a woman gives birth helps create who she is as a mother. When a woman is fully informed about the choices she makes, and fully participates in her birth process, her confidence as a mother is enhanced. Every woman deserves to have caring, compassionate, knowledgeable support at every step of the way - during pregnancy, during labor and birth, and in the postpartum period.
As your doula, I will work with you and your partner to help create a powerful and satisfying birth experience. I provide education about the birth process, a variety of comfort measures during labor. I do not make choices for you, but I can help navigate by supporting you to make choices that are best for you and your family.
I also provide support in the immediate postpartum period to help initiate breastfeeding, and later in your home to provide support and answer any questions you might have. I am passionate about breastfeeding and have a lot of experience in supporting the breastfeeding relationship and in dealing with problems when they arise. I believe that good support early on is invaluable to successful breastfeeding.
I have been working with moms and babies since 2007 as both a labor and postpartum doula. I also attend births as an apprentice midwife and work with new moms during the early postpartum period at one of the Portland birth centers. Before embarking on this journey in birth work, I had been working with children in a variety of settings for over 10 years and had a career as a Montessori teacher in Chicago, Illinois.
